What is a Funnel Cake?

Funnel cakes are made by pouring batter thru a funnel into hot oil in a circular motion. The batter is fried lightly in the hot oil until it is golden brown and then topped with powdered sugar or other toppings.

What is the Best Oil for Frying Funnel Cake?

To get the perfect crispy on the outside soft on the inside texture for the perfect funnel cakes from scratch the best oils to use are vegetable, canola, or peanut oil.

Can you Refrigerate Funnel Cake Batter?

Yes! If you have leftover batter, store it in the fridge in an airtight container. It will keep for 2 days.

Tips for Making this Recipe

Don’t let the oil get too hot. If the oil is too hot the funnel cake will fall apart.

Drain the funnel cake after removing it from the oil. There will be excess oil when it is done frying, remove the funnel cake and place it on a paper towel lined plate for about a minute and then pour on the powdered sugar.

Drizzle in a swirl motion. To get the funnel cake from scratch to look like the ones at the fair, drizzle the batter around in a circular motion around the pan.

Size doesn’t matter. You can make large funnel cakes or small funnel cakes, the sizing choice is up to you. I just recommend leaving enough room in the pan to be able to flip them easily.

Funnel Cake Topping Ideas

Confectioner’s sugar. If you want to go with classic fair food then you will want to sprinkle confectioner’s sugar on top. When adding powdered sugar make sure you add a generous sprinkling because the funnel cake will absorb some of the powdered sugar.

Strawberries and cream. Whipped cream and chopped strawberries.

Caramel Apple Funnel Cake. Caramel sauce drizzled on top with chopped apples.

S’Mores Funnel Cake. Homemade Chocolate hot fudge drizzle, crushed up graham crackers, and mini marshmallows.

Churro Funnel Cake. Sprinkle with cinnamon and sugar.

Top with Ice Cream. Scoop your favorite ice cream on top and if you want to make it a sundae add some whipped cream and a cherry too. We also love adding hot fudge sauce on top for an extra special treat.

Chocolate Sauce. One of my kid’s favorite toppings is chocolate sauce, you can use the store bought or make homemade chocolate fudge and either drizzle it on top or dip into it.

Fresh Fruit. On top of powdered sugar blueberries, strawberries and raspberries are great to put on top.

Homemade Funnel Cakes Ingredients

  • Salt
  • Baking Powder
  • all purpose Flour
  • Eggs
  • Sugar
  • Milk
  • Powdered Sugar
  • Oil (for frying). You can use vegetable oil, or canola oil, we prefer to use vegetable oil.

How to make Homemade Funnel Cakes

In a large bowl and add the baking powder, salt, and flour in a bowl and mix together.

Homemade Funnel Cake Recipe (7)

Then in another bowl add the eggs, sugar, and milk in a bowl and mix until they are creamed.

Homemade Funnel Cake Recipe (8)

Carefully add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until smooth.

Homemade Funnel Cake Recipe (9)

The batter needs to be thin enough that you can pour it.

Pour the batter into a glass measuring cup or a squeeze bottle.

Line a plate with paper towels.

Add the oil to a heavy skillet so it is 1 – 1.5 inches deep.

Heat the oil over medium heat to 375°F.

Pour the funnel cake mix in a circular motion to make the well know funnel cake shape, fry until golden brown, and then using kitchen tongs flip it over and fry the other side for about 1 minute.

Place your funnel cake on a plate to drain then top with sifted powdered sugar or any other toppings you are wanting.

Continue making funnel cakes with the remaining batter until it is all used up.
